76667 vs 76661: cost of living, income and home prices

ZIP 76667 (Texas) has a median household income of $46,130 and a typical home value of $108,900. ZIP 76661 (Texas) sits at $31,888 and $78,200.

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(5-year). Latest observation ACS 2022.

Measure7666776661
Median household income$46,130$31,888
Median home value$108,900$78,200
Median gross rent$768$558
Median age38.6 yrs36.4 yrs
Homeownership rate69.6%71.3%
Bachelor's degree or higher9.5%4.9%

Methodology

Both columns use ZIP Code Tabulation Area estimates from the same Census release, so the comparison is like for like.

We only publish comparisons where both areas have at least 5,000 residents, which keeps the margin of error usable.

Sources: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(5-year). American Community Survey 5-year estimates, 2022.
